Introduction to Four Floor: Definition and History

Four Floor is a dynamic sub-genre of electronic dance music characterized by a consistent four-on-the-floor beat, where the bass drum hits on every beat of the measure. Originating in the late 1970s and gaining prominence during the 1980s disco and house movements, Four Floor became a cornerstone of club music culture. Its development was influenced by disco, early house music in Chicago, and techno sounds from Detroit. Over time, Four Floor evolved into various styles, incorporating modern EDM elements, trance, and progressive beats, while maintaining its signature driving rhythm that makes it instantly recognizable and danceable.

Four Floor Sub-tags and Classifications

  • Classic Four Floor

    Classic Four Floor refers to the original style of four-on-the-floor electronic dance music, characterized by steady bass drum beats,Four Floor Music Overview simple hi-hat rhythms, and minimalistic melodic layers. This style often emphasizes groove and danceability over complex harmonic structures, making it ideal for clubs and dance floors.

  • Progressive Four Floor

    Progressive Four Floor integrates melodic and harmonic complexity with the traditional four-on-the-floor rhythm. Often featuring layered synths, evolving textures, and gradual build-ups, this sub-tag creates an immersive listening experience, appealing to both casual listeners and EDM enthusiasts.

  • Vocal Four Floor

    Vocal Four Floor incorporates prominent vocal lines or samples on top of the driving four-on-the-floor beat. This sub-tag is popular in mainstream electronic music and radio-friendly EDM tracks, blending lyrical storytelling with rhythmic energy.

  • Techno-influenced Four Floor

    Techno-influenced Four Floor combines the repetitive four-on-the-floor rhythm with darker, more mechanical soundscapes. It often features syncopated percussion, atmospheric synths, and minimalistic arrangements, appealing to underground club scenes and experimental electronic music fans.

Famous Artists and Classic Works in Four Floor

Frankie Knuckles

Known as the 'Godfather of House Music,' Frankie Knuckles played a crucial role in popularizing Four Floor rhythms in the Chicago club scene. His remixes and DJ sets set the foundation for the modern Four Floor sound, influencing countless artists and tracks.

Frankie Knuckles – Baby Powder

This track exemplifies early Four Floor rhythms with its steady bass drum foundation, crisp hi-hats, and soulful synth melodies. It showcases how the genre emphasizes groove and danceability while remaining minimalistic and elegant.

David Guetta

David Guetta brought Four Floor to mainstream EDM audiences, blending it with pop elements and vocal hooks. His tracks showcase the versatility of Four Floor beats in commercial music and festival settings.

David Guetta – When Love Takes Over

A prime example of Vocal Four Floor, this track merges driving four-on-the-floor beats with powerful vocals and pop sensibilities. Its combination of rhythmic consistency and melodic hooks illustrates the modern commercial potential of Four Floor music.

Armand Van Helden

Armand Van Helden is known for his innovative Four Floor productions, combining funk, disco, and house influences. His work demonstrates the genre's adaptability and enduring appeal on dance floors worldwide.

Armand Van Helden – The Funk Phenomena

This track fuses classic house elements with funky basslines and a persistent four-on-the-floor beat. It highlights the genre's flexibility, allowing experimentation with rhythm, melody, and electronic textures while maintaining dance floor energy.
